The baby name Sebynah is a Female name , 3 syllables long and is pronounced seh-BY-nah (SEH-bye-nah); alternative pronunciation: seh-BEE-nah.

Sebynah is a rare modern feminine name, likely a creative respelling that blends the Latin-rooted Sabina/Sabine with the popular -nah ending. While the form itself has little documented use before the late 20th century, its components are time-honored: Sabina derives from the Roman cognomen meaning "a woman of the Sabine people," and Sabrina is the Latinized name associated with the River Severn and a Celtic river legend, its exact meaning unknown. The inserted y reflects contemporary English naming aesthetics and signals a distinct identity.
Usage is sporadic across English-speaking countries, where Sebynah appears as a tailored alternative to more familiar classics. Close variants and near-equivalents include Sebina, Sebena, Sebyna, Sabina, Sabine, Sabrina, and Savina. Possible nicknames are Seb, Sebi, Bina, and Nah/Nahna. Because its form is modern, parents often anchor its "meaning" to the Sabina line - heritage, strength, and Roman elegance - while enjoying a unique twist.
Sebynah does not appear in any of the birth registries or name datasets we track. This usually means it's either extremely rare, a regional/traditional name not captured by official statistics, or a brand-new coinage. Use it knowing your child will almost certainly be the only one in the room.
